Crowd-Favourite Categories of Novelty Gifts
1. Funny Mugs
A classic for a reason. Start his day with a laugh:
- “World’s Okayest Husband”
- “Instant Human: Just Add Coffee”
- “Dad Jokes Loading…”
Perfect for home offices, work desks, or man caves. These mugs top the charts for birthday presents for blokes who appreciate dry humour.
2. Kitchen Gear That Brings the Banter
Who says kitchen tools have to be boring?
- BBQ aprons with cheeky slogans
- Sizzling steak branding kits
- Beer chillers disguised as grenades
- Joke cookbooks (think: “101 Ways to Burn Toast”)
Solid gold for birthday presents for lads who think they’re Gordon Ramsay after a few beers.
